Norwich, England’s Institution of East Anglia, is a public research university. When it began in 1963, there was enough classroom space for about 1,200 students. We currently house more than 17,000 students. In the QS World University Rankings 2024, it ranks #=295th. In the list of Best Global Universities, the University of East Anglia is rated #330. The University of East Anglia (UEA) is listed in the UK Top 30 by the Guardian University 2023 guide and in the UK Top 25 by the Complete University Guide 2024. It is a central scientific hub that influences change on a global scale. 79% of applicants are accepted to the University.

Entry Requirements

High School: Obtained after 13 years of schooling, you may be eligible for direct admission to undergraduate programs. 

A LEVEL: BBB—CCC

INTERNATIONAL BACCALAUREATE: 28 points

Postgraduate

Undergraduate degree holders are typically given preference while applying for master’s degrees. We require an equivalent to a UK 2:1 for the majority of courses. 

English Language Requirements

IELTS: 6.0 total with a minimum of 5.5 in each component

TOEFL: 79 total Reading 18 Writing 17 Listening 17 Speaking 20

Postgraduate

IELTS: 6.0 overall, with two components requiring a minimum of 5.5 and the remaining three requiring 6.0

TOEFL: 79 overall Reading 18 Writing 17 Listening 17 Speaking 20

University of East Anglia Scholarship undergraduate and postgraduate

International Country Award

Students who are citizens or have their permanent residence in any of the following nations at the time of application—Canada, Egypt, India, Indonesia, Kenya, Japan, Jordan, Malaysia, Mauritius, Pakistan, Singapore, South Korea, Turkey, United Arab Emirates, and the United States of America—will automatically be awarded this scholarship. 

Type of Course: Undergraduate

Funding Type: Tuition Fees

Total Value: Â£4000

Students who are citizens or have their permanent residence in any of the following nations at the time of application—Canada, Egypt, India, Indonesia, Kenya, South Korea, Japan, Jordan, Malaysia, Mauritius, Norway, Pakistan, Singapore, Turkey, United Arab Emirates, and the United States of America—will automatically be awarded this scholarship. 

Eligible candidates will receive £4,000 off their first-year tuition fees.
